**Core Concept**
The SA-14-14-2 Japanese Encephalitis (JE) vaccine is a live attenuated vaccine designed to protect against JE virus infection, a significant cause of viral encephalitis in Asia. The vaccine works by inducing immune responses against the JE virus, thereby preventing the disease.

**Clinical Pearl / High-Yield Fact**
The SA-14-14-2 JE vaccine is a critical tool in preventing JE virus infection in endemic areas, particularly in rural regions where the disease is most common. It is recommended that individuals traveling to JE-endemic areas receive the vaccine to protect against this potentially life-threatening disease.
